Tutorial Tuesday :: Summer Knit Cardigan with FREE Sewing Pattern from iCandy Handmade

Girl Charlee New Arrivals have filled up with lightweight Hacci Sweater Knits and Cotton Jersey Knits that are perfect for warm weather cover ups and blouses. For this weeks Tutorial Tuesday, we have an adorable Summer Knit Cardigan Tutorial from Jen of iCandy Handmade. As an added bonus, Jen provides her FREE sewing pattern in two sizes. The size Small is modeled here by a friend's daughter and the size Medium can be found here.


If you're new to sewing with Hacci Sweater Knits, this is the perfect place to start because this tutorial is so simple to follow. Jen provides both written instructions and photographs that take you every step of the way. It looks so cute and easy, I think I'm going to make one of these out of every fabric in my stash!


You can also check out Jen's charming sweater here


Any lightweight knit fabric would be perfect for this cardigan. I suggest starting your search with light to medium weight Cotton Jersey and Hacci Sweater knits. A few of my picks from the store:
